Start With Licensing and Player Protection
A valid gambling licence is the first essential checkpoint. Regulated operators must generally follow rules covering identity verification, responsible gambling, technical testing, complaints, and the separation of customer funds. The licensing authority should be named clearly in the website footer, with a registration number that can be checked through the regulator’s official database.
Do not treat a licence badge as proof of perfect service. Read the operator’s responsible gambling policy, privacy notice, and dispute procedure. Strong protection tools may include deposit limits, cooling-off periods, reality checks, session reminders, self-exclusion, and the ability to restrict specific products.
Compare Bonuses by Their Conditions
A large welcome bonus can look attractive while offering limited practical value. The headline amount is only one part of the offer. Review the minimum deposit, wagering requirement, eligible games, maximum bet, expiry period, withdrawal restrictions, and contribution rates before accepting promotional funds.
| Bonus factor | Why it matters | What to check |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| Determines how many times qualifying funds must be played through | Whether it applies to the deposit, bonus, or both |
| Game contribution | Shows which products count toward turnover | Different percentages for slots, table games, and live casino |
| Maximum stake | Can invalidate a promotion if exceeded | The permitted amount per spin, hand, or round |
| Expiry period | Limits the time available to complete requirements | The exact deadline and applicable time zone |
| Withdrawal rules | May restrict access to winnings or promotional balances | Verification, maximum cash-out, and cancellation clauses |
Promotions are commercial incentives, not guaranteed profit. Compare the expected value of the entire offer with the restrictions attached to it. A smaller promotion with clear terms may be more useful than an impressive headline with severe limitations.
Assess Games, Software, and Fairness
A credible casino identifies its software suppliers and provides a broad catalogue without disguising important conditions. Look for recognised developers, independent testing references, published return-to-player information, and clear explanations of progressive jackpot rules. Random number generators should be tested by approved laboratories, while live casino tables should disclose streaming and settlement procedures.
Game variety matters only when it matches your preferences and budget. Slots may offer rapid play and varied themes, whereas table games require attention to rules, limits, and house edge. Live dealer products can add transparency but often use higher minimum stakes. Check the lobby for filtering tools, demo access where available, and visible betting ranges.
Examine Payments and Account Operations
Payment quality often reveals how an operator treats customers. Reliable casinos display deposit and withdrawal methods before sign-up, explain processing times, and disclose fees. Card payments, bank transfers, and approved digital wallets may have different limits and verification requirements. A fast deposit does not guarantee a fast withdrawal.
- Confirm the minimum and maximum transaction amounts.
- Check whether deposits and withdrawals must use the same method.
- Read the identity verification requirements before requesting cash-out.
- Review currency conversion charges and possible banking fees.
- Save transaction receipts, bonus terms, and support correspondence.
Identity checks are normal in regulated gambling, particularly when financial crime controls apply. However, an operator should explain what documents are needed, how they are stored, and why additional checks may be requested. Avoid platforms that pressure you to deposit before basic account information is available.
Use a Controlled Decision Process
Customer support should be tested before money is committed. Ask a specific question through live chat or email and evaluate response speed, accuracy, and professionalism. A useful help centre, accessible terms, and a clear complaints route are stronger trust signals than promotional language.
Set a personal budget before playing and treat it as entertainment spending. Never chase losses, borrow money to gamble, or increase stakes because a bonus is close to expiring. If gambling begins to affect bills, relationships, sleep, or concentration, stop and use the available blocking and support services.
